He’s been courted for years to host a daytime talk show — and after testing the waters, T.D. Jakes will finally make it happen.

Through a deal with Tegna Media, the pastor will host a syndicated series targeted for a fall 2016 debut, reports Variety. Tegna Media, an arm of station group Tegna (formerly known as Gannett Broadcasting), will distribute the show and carry it in more than 20 top markets, including Atlanta, Cleveland, Dallas and Denver.

The show had a test run in several Tegna markets that was successful enough for the company to chance a national rollout.

“With Jakes at the helm, this program has an opportunity to attract blue-chip advertisers, generate large audiences and empower viewers across the country,” said Dave Lougee, president of Tegna Media. “During the show’s test run this summer, Jakes’ audience grew each week in every market. Once viewers found him, they liked him and we look forward to introducing him to a wider audience next fall.”
